Design Build
Planning
NEPA
ROW / Utilities
Design / Construction
In DB project delivery, the design-builder assumes
responsibility for the majority of design work and all
construction. This gives the design-builder increased
flexibility to be innovative, along with greater responsibility
and risk.
Benefits:
Considerable time savings over Design-Bid-Build (DBB)
Allows design tailored to contractor resources
Allows quality evaluation factors and best-value criteria
when selecting contractor

Construction Manager/General
Contractor (CMGC)
Planning
NEPA
ROW / Utilities
Design / Construction
CM/GC speeds the project by allowing the owner to contract
with a construction manager early in the design process and
negotiate a price before design is complete.
Benefits:
Reduces costs
No compromise on quality
Enhances potential for creativity

Warm Mix Asphalt
Reduces the temperature of mixing
pavement materials, resulting in cost
savings and reduced greenhouse gas
emissions
Benefits:
Better compaction
Reduces worker fatigue
Reduces fossil fuel consumption
Reduces CO2e & other emissions
Longer paving season
Warm Mix Asphalt
National Goal:
40 State DOTs and all Federal Lands Divisions allow WMA in
specifications and/or contract language by December 2011
At least 30 State DOTs achieve targets for WMA usage by
December 2012
Indiana:
Implemented in Indiana
INDOT specifications have allowed WMA since May 2009
379 contracts let in 2010 with WMA

Safety Edge
Sloped pavement edge at 30º angle
allows drivers a more controlled reentry to the roadway after tire
drop-off.
Benefits:
Reduces crashes due to edge
drop-off and uncontrolled recovery
Minimal cost (less than 1% on
two-lane highway)
Consolidated edge increases
durability

Geosynthetic Reinforced Soil (GRS)
Integrated Bridge System (IBS)
Fast, cost-effective bridge support using
alternating layers of compacted fill and layers
of geosynthetic reinforcement.
Many benefits:
Eliminates approach slab or construction
joint at the bridge-to-road interface
Reduced construction time (Complete in
days!)
Less dependent on weather conditions
Flexible design – easily modified to site
conditions
Built with readily-available equipment and
materials

Adaptive Signal Control
ACS measures traffic and
adjusts signal timing to
promote smooth flow along
arterial streets
Benefits:
Improves travel time
reliability, reduces congestion,
smoothes traffic flow
Increases long-term viability
of traffic signal operations
Widely deployable using
existing control equipment
